Output 17cf24c9024756746b2f810fbf12615b239cca6e7a0a97ec2d0d623850685fdd:12

value
587014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88fb876e4a923cd4291cb85949541f069f5f815b OP_EQUAL
address
3EBK9B9oezkDNedk6xDjd4nz5oGe2KWPpY
transaction
17cf24c9024756746b2f810fbf12615b239cca6e7a0a97ec2d0d623850685fdd
spent
true